What makes the Citroën C4 Cactus so special? The Citroën C4 Cactus has revolutionized the compact segment with its bold design. With its flowing lines and distinctive features, it’s sure to stand out. One of the most striking features is undoubtedly the Airbump system, which provides visual and physical protection against minor bumps and scratches. This aesthetic and practical choice reflects Citroën’s commitment to combining style and functionality.

- Technical specifications and performance of the Citroën C4 Cactus
- The Citroën C4 Cactus offers several engines suited to different driving styles. Available in petrol and diesel versions, the latter are designed to offer a good compromise between performance and fuel consumption. The petrol version, for example, is appreciated for its responsiveness, while diesel users highlight the low fuel consumption on long journeys.
| Engine | Power | Fuel consumption (L/100km) | Fuel type |
|———————|———–|————————|——————–|
| 1.2 PureTech | 110 hp | 5.5 | Petrol |
| 1.6 BlueHDi | 100 hp | 3.8 | Diesel |
| 1.6 PureTech | 130 hp | 5.9 | Petrol | Engine

Compared to its competitors, the C4 Cactus offers attractive value for money. Indeed, models like the Volkswagen T-Roc or the Nissan Juke will often cost more for similar equipment. While the latter may offer a more dynamic driving experience, the C4 Cactus stands out for its comfort and interior space. 💰 Good value for money 🚙 Competitive with more expensive models 🚗 Optimal driving comfort Comfort and ergonomics: The on-board experience The comfort on board the Citroën C4 Cactus is one of its major strengths. Numerous user testimonials report a pleasant and practical atmosphere, with quality materials that provide a feeling of well-being. The seats are well-designed, allowing for long hours of driving without excessive fatigue.
In terms of space, the C4 Cactus boasts a trunk depth that rivals higher-class models. This makes it a wise choice for those looking for a practical vehicle for their daily commute or weekend getaways.

Connected Technologies
With the development of automotive technology, the C4 Cactus is evolving with connectivity options. The integrated navigation system and various smartphone apps such as Apple CarPlay and Android Auto make driving a modern and interactive experience. This meets the growing demand from users for connected vehicles, while allowing them to keep their hands on the wheel.
